2013/2/1 Andrew Dunstan <and...@dunslane.net>: > > On 02/01/2013 10:38 AM, Tom Lane wrote: >> >> Andrew Dunstan <and...@dunslane.net> writes: >>> >>> fmgr.c contains this: >>> * DEPRECATED, DO NOT USE IN NEW CODE >>> Should we just drop all support for the old interface now? >> >> Is there any actual benefit to removing it? I don't recall that >> it's been the source of any maintenance burden. I'd be fine with >> dropping it if it were costing us something measurable, but ... >> >> > > > > My hope was that if we got rid of the old stuff we wouldn't need to use > > PG_FUNCTION_INFO_V1(myfunc); >
removing function descriptor should not be good idea - it can be used for some annotation. I had a similar issue - and can be nice, if it is solved with some assertions. Regards Pavel > > > in external modules any more (I recently got bitten through forgetting this > and it cost me an hour or two). > > cheers > > andrew > > > > > -- >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org) > To make changes to your subscription: > http://www.postgresql.org/mailpref/pgsql-hackers --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-hackers